Understanding GI Sheets:
Galvanized Iron sheets, ordinarily known as GI sheets, go through an extraordinary course of galvanization, wherein they are coated with a layer of zinc. This zinc covering goes about as a defensive shield, making an impressive boundary against corrosive components. The outcome is a material that flaunts upgraded strength as well as shows exceptional resistance to the corrosive impacts of moisture, oxygen, and environmental contaminants.
Key Characteristics of GI Sheets:
The essential trademark that separates GI sheets is their remarkable resistance to corrosion. The zinc covering goes about as a conciliatory layer, defending the basic iron from the corrosive powers of the environment.
GI sheets embody wonderful durability, contributing essentially to the longevity of structures. Their corrosion-safe properties guarantee that structures sustained with GI sheets keep up with their structural trustworthiness over an extended period.
GI sheets exhibit versatility in application, pursuing them a favored decision for an expansive range of construction projects. From roofing to cladding and structural framing, GI sheets adjust consistently to assorted construction needs.
GI sheets are known for their ease of fabrication. Developers and producers can cut, shape, and control these sheets to suit explicit design prerequisites, allowing for flexibility and customization in construction projects.
Applications of GI Sheets:
GI sheets are widely utilized in roofing applications. Their corrosion resistance, combined with durability, pursues an optimal decision for safeguarding structures against the components. Furthermore, GI sheets track down application in cladding, adding to both tasteful allure and structural resilience.
GI sheets assume an urgent part in structural framing. Whether utilized in walls, support beams, or other burden bearing components, the corrosion-safe nature of GI sheets adds to the soundness and longevity of the construction.
Because of their durability and resistance to corrosion, GI sheets are a phenomenal decision for fencing and enclosures. They give a strong and persevering answer for making boundaries, adding to security and protection.
GI sheets track down applications past construction in the automotive and modern areas. Their strength and corrosion resistance make them reasonable for manufacturing components for vehicles and modern equipment.
Advantages of GI Sheets:
The essential benefit of GI sheets lies in their unrivaled protection against corrosion. The zinc covering goes about as a vigorous hindrance, fundamentally diminishing the gamble of structural harm brought about by corrosion.
While the underlying interest in GI sheets might be higher than untreated iron, their long-term cost efficiency becomes obvious over the lifespan of a design. Decreased maintenance and substitution costs add to the monetary advantages of utilizing GI sheets.
GI sheets offer versatility in design and fabrication. Their flexibility allows for simple molding and customization, enabling planners and manufacturers to meet explicit stylish and structural prerequisites.
The zinc covering on GI sheets is recyclable, lining up with environmental sustainability. Furthermore, the durability and longevity of GI sheets add to reasonable construction rehearses by lessening material utilization and waste.
